• DocumentCode
    3549560
  • Title

    Integrating Object-Z with timed automata

  • Author

    Dong, J.S. ; Duke, R. ; Hao, P.

  • Author_Institution
    National Univ. of Singapore, Singapore
  • fYear
    2005
  • fDate
    16-20 June 2005
  • Firstpage
    488
  • Lastpage
    497
  • Abstract
    When designing a complex system, Object-Z is a powerful logic-based language for modeling the system state aspects, and timed automata is an excellent graph-based notation for capturing timed control behaviour of the system. This paper presents an effective combination of the two techniques with novel composition and communication mechanisms. The combined notation enhances Object-Z with realtime modeling capability and also extends timed automata with enhanced structure and state modeling features.
  • Keywords
    finite automata; formal specification; graph theory; logic programming languages; object-oriented programming; Object-Z; formal specification; graph-based notation; logic-based language; realtime modeling; system design; system state aspect modeling; system timed control behaviour; timed automata; Automata; Automatic control; Communication system control; Control systems; Europe; North America; Power system modeling; Real time systems; Software engineering; Software systems; Object-Z; Specification; Timed Automata;
  • fLanguage
    English
  • Publisher
    ieee
  • Conference_Titel
    Engineering of Complex Computer Systems, 2005. ICECCS 2005. Proceedings. 10th IEEE International Conference on
  • Print_ISBN
    0-7695-2284-X
  • Type

    conf

  • DOI
    10.1109/ICECCS.2005.56
  • Filename
    1467931